No call list

My friend Brendan was just telling me that the telephone woke him up at 7 am this morning . . . and it was a telemarketer! We promptly enrolled him on the Missouri no call list. If you don't like getting calls from telemarketers, then I recommend this. It's easy to do over the internet. Just go to http://www.ago.state.mo.us/nocall/. Put in your information and they'll send you a packet in the mail that will tell you how to report violators. State legislators are also considering a no-email list, which could help eliminate some of the spam that clogs your in-box. Check out the news story here.
